My Buying Guides on Washable Markers For Whiteboards

When I shop for washable markers for whiteboards, I look beyond just the color. I want markers that write smoothly, erase easily, and do not leave annoying stains or ghost marks behind. Over time, I have learned that a good whiteboard marker can make daily writing, teaching, meetings, or planning much more pleasant.

1. I Check the Erasability First

The most important thing for me is how easily the marker wipes off the board. I prefer markers that come off cleanly with a dry eraser or soft cloth, without needing a lot of scrubbing. If a marker claims to be washable, I still test whether it leaves residue or faint shadows after a few days of use.

2. I Look for Smooth Ink Flow

I want the ink to flow evenly without skipping or blotting. A marker that writes too dry can feel scratchy, while one that is too wet can smear and take longer to dry. For me, the best markers strike a balance: bold enough to read clearly, but not so wet that they run across the board.

3. I Pay Attention to Tip Type

The tip makes a big difference in how I use the marker. I usually choose based on the task:

  • Bullet tip for general writing and everyday use
  • Chisel tip for both thick and thin lines
  • Fine tip for small notes and detailed writing

If I need versatility, I usually go with a chisel tip because it gives me more control.

4. I Prefer Low-Odor Ink

If I am using markers in a classroom, office, or small room, odor matters to me. Low-odor ink makes the experience much more comfortable, especially during long meetings or lessons. I always try to avoid markers with a strong chemical smell.

5. I Check the Color Brightness

I like markers that are easy to read from a distance. Bright, vivid colors help my writing stand out on the whiteboard. Black and blue are my everyday favorites, but I also like red, green, and purple for organizing ideas or highlighting important points.

6. I Consider Drying Time

A marker that dries too slowly can smear when I accidentally touch the board. I prefer one that dries quickly enough to avoid smudges but still gives me time to write naturally. This is especially important when I am writing quickly during presentations.

7. I Look at Longevity and Ink Capacity

I do not want markers that run out too quickly. I usually check how long they last, especially if I use whiteboards often. A marker with good ink capacity saves me money and reduces the hassle of replacing them frequently.

8. I Make Sure They Are Safe and Easy to Clean

Since I use markers around other people, I like products that are non-toxic and safe for regular use. I also prefer markers that do not stain hands, clothes, or furniture easily. Even though they are washable, I still want to be careful and choose a reliable brand.

9. I Think About the Surface I Use Them On

Not every whiteboard is the same. Some boards erase more easily than others, so I make sure the marker works well on the type of surface I use most. If I have a glass board or a coated board, I check whether the marker is compatible before buying.

10. I Read Reviews Before I Buy

I always find it helpful to read what other users say. Reviews tell me whether the marker truly erases well, how long it lasts, and whether the colors stay bright. I trust real user experiences because they often reveal things product descriptions leave out.
